🇺🇸 USAF — Project Blue Book
In September 1951, a witness in Hollywood, California, observed two glowing red objects moving toward the moon. One emitted a brilliant white flash, while the other remained behind the celestial body. According to the report, the objects were three times as long as the moon's diameter. The witness described their disappearance as if they ascended and vanished into space. Although the official report attributed the sighting to the witness's overactive imagination, the testimony includes remarkable details about the precision of movement, speed, and apparent advanced technology.
The official report suggests it could be a meteor, a balloon, or even an aircraft, but the testimony describes an experience that goes beyond the conventional.
